App Builder from Infragistics allows you to publish and synchronize Angular apps to #GitHub. This video steps you through this process and then shows you what gets published to GitHub. Also, you will learn how to manage GitHub sync changes, and how to merge those changes to your existing branch
GitHub is a favorite tool for millions of developers for source control, so this App Builder functionality allows users to benefit from all GitHub features, such as assigning reviewers, tracking changes, commenting and many more.

The App Builder is a WYSIWYG drag and drop app development tool that not only simplifies how you build UI designs but also facilitates and modernizes app development. Packed with tons of useful features to allow you to start your app from scratch or choose from a library of pre-built app templates and responsive screen layouts. The App Builder includes a toolbox of 60+ UI controls, generates a production-ready code in HTML, TypeScript & CSS for Angular and Razor and SCSS for Blazor (with React and Web Components coming soon), styling and customization options. You also get to import Sketch and Adobe XD Designs, bind data, and more.
